if you have good wires... sparks with the switch OUT then the switch is bad or wrong type.
it should NORMALLY OPEN when not pressed ... just check it with a ohmmeter.... don't assume we know what that does.
if relays click next step is to check what comes out to feed power to the t&T motor..assuming a 2 wire T&T check for +12 and ground to the trim motor via blue-green or your colors if different . up and down just reverses the power and grd. check fuses or any interrupt feature of...

that allen head oil plug leaking may not be tighten down enough on a NEW NYLON GASKET ..
personnally I prefer slotted ones because the allen head ones s trip easier if forced. they are a pin to remove if stripped. you have to punch them out bacwards
